【巨杉数据库Sequoiadb】如何通过oid值定位该记录存储在哪个数据节点
发表于:2025-11-07 作者:千家信息网编辑
千家信息网最后更新 2025年11月07日,【客 户场 景】 现在客户直接通过驱动进行在线交易,交易时会把 oid 或者唯一 键值 打印到 业务 系 统 日志中,在 实际 交易的 时 候交易成功了,但是有 时 候 发 生交易 缓 慢,如果可以
千家信息网最后更新 2025年11月07日【巨杉数据库Sequoiadb】如何通过oid值定位该记录存储在哪个数据节点
【客 户场 景】
现在客户直接通过驱动进行在线交易,交易时会把 oid 或者唯一 键值 打印到 业务 系 统 日志中,在 实际 交易的 时 候交易成功了,但是有 时 候 发 生交易 缓 慢,如果可以直接定位到哪个数据 节 点就可以直接到相 应 的日志目 录 去 检查 日志,然后分析 缓 慢的原因
【 问题 】
如何通 过 oid 值定位该记录存储在哪个数据节点上?
【解决 办 法】
1. oid 是一个 12 字 节 的 BSON 对象,构成:
4 字 节 精确到秒的 时间 戳
3 字 节 系 统 (物理机) 标 示
2 字 节进 程 ID
3 字 节 由随机数起始的序列号
2. 无法 仅仅 通 过 oid 值确定记录落在哪个数据节点。若 oid 为分区键,在自动切分的情况下,可以结合分区信息,推断记录所在的数据节点。在这种情况下,可使用以下工具确认记录所在的数据节点: sdbshard.tar.gz ,下 载 地址:
http://pmr.sequoiadb.com:8090/download/attachments/13205507/sdbshard.tar.gz?version=1&modificationDate=1507796046000&api=v2
【参考 资 料】
oid 定 义 : http://doc.sequoiadb.com/cn/SequoiaDB-cat_id-1519612292-edition_id-0
数据
交易
节点
日志
定位
情况
所在
存储
精确
成功
业务
信息
原因
在线交易
地址
实际
客户
对象
工具
序列
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
软件开发的帖子
无锡那个公司做软件开发
DB2数据库名称和别名
宕昌县有什么数据库
软件开发公司的口碑
天津 银行软件开发中心待遇
t3数据库安装不兼容
苹果浏览器连接到服务器的教程
菏泽市编委数据库
什么是数字化软件开发
计算机网络技术属于什么系部
若依系统怎么建数据库
哈利波特 哪个服务器
湖州服务器精密空调安装
企业微信根服务器
我的世界暑期必玩的三个服务器
php 获取服务器环境
100万软件开发
数据库重做回滚问题原理
股票交易软件开发厦门
楚雄网络安全等级
服务器输入输出处理部件
软件开发如何避免误触
福山区app定制软件开发企业
什么是软件开发的最困难的
网络安全监测胎心男女
上海视频安防软件开发价格
多人录入数据进数据库
苯甲酸物竞数据库
汕尾网络安全举报电话